1896 Print Caton Woodville Berlin Napoleonic War Cannon Destruction Lange XEGA9 XGL8 from the Diamond Chain &This is an original 1896 black and white halftone print of a Berlin blacksmith slamming a nail into a French cannon's touch hole, rendering it useless to the French garrison's soldiers occupying Berlin since the War of the Fourth Coalition. Earlier that day, Russian forces had entered the city and harassed the garrison there, prompting a small rebellion from the population.
